By Walton Jones, featuring the greatest songs from the 1930’s & 40’s. Direct from the Hotel Astor’s Algonquin Room in NYC, join The Mutual Manhattan Variety Cavalcade as they present a “live” radio broadcast on December 21, 1942. The spirit of that bygone era comes alive with a behind-the-scenes look at the fun and drama of producing a live radio show. And of course, not everything runs smoothly! Featuring such great songs as Strike Up the Band, Boogie Woogie Bugle Boy and I’ll Be Seeing You, this sweet, charming and funny show is one from and for the memory books!
